发明名称 IMAGE PROCESSING DEVICE AND METHOD FOR OPERATING ENDOSCOPE SYSTEM
摘要 Provided are an image processing device and a method for operating an endoscope system which, when studying a microvessel and a microstructure independently, are capable of generating an endoscopic image in which one of the structures does not interfere with visualization of the other structure. A base image (105) includes a B image signal which has a duct structure (S) that is brighter than the mucous membrane and a microvessel (V) that is darker than the mucous membrane. A frequency filtering process which extracts a frequency component that includes the duct structure (S) and the microvessel (V) is applied to the B image signal, and a structure extraction image signal is generated in which the pixel value of the duct structure (S) is positive and the pixel value of the microvessel (V) is negative. A display controlling image (100) which is used for emphasizing the duct structure (S) and suppressing the microvessel (V) is generated on the basis of the structure extraction image signal. By compositing the base image (105) and the display controlling image (100), a display controlled image (110) is obtained in which the duct structure (S) is emphasized and the microvessel (V) is suppressed.
